Court serves fresh notices to Prabhu Deva and Nayantara

A
family
court
has
issued
fresh
notice
to
Prabhu
Deva
and
Nayantara
after
they
failed
to
attend
court
hearing
yesterday
(October
19).
The
actors
neither
turned
up
nor
sent
their
representatives
to
the
court.
But
Latha
Prabhu
Deva
was
present
along
with
her
counsel.
Meenakshisundaram,
the
principal
judge
for
family
courts,
served
notices
to
Prabhu
and
Nayan
and
postponed
the
proceedings
to
November
23.
Earlier
this
month,
Latha
had
filed
two
petitions
in
a
family
court
in
Chennai
seeking
to
direct
her
husband
to
live
with
her
and
restore
her
conjugal
rights.
However,
Latha's
lawyer
said
that
he
has
summoned
Prabhu
Deva.
But
he
could
not
summon
Nayantara
because
she
does
not
have
a
permanent
address
in
Chennai.
The
counsel
added
that
he
attempted
to
serve
the
notice
to
her
through
South
Indian
Film
Artistes
Association
but
it
turned
down
his
plea.
